From e1130a96740e1d3180b2aa5a2874d5598ea9320b Mon Sep 17 00:00:00 2001 From: justin ljj Date: Mon, 27 Aug 2012 16:27:23 +0800 Subject: [PATCH] support 'send_arp_for_ha' option in l3_agent Fixes bug 1042046 Sending gratuitous ARPs when a external router or a floating IP was added in order to facilitate HA. I am using iputils-arping package to send ARP packets. You will need to install iputils-arping on Ubuntu and iputils on Fedora/RHEL/CentOS. Arping locates in /usr/bin/arping on Ubuntu and locates in /sbin/arping on Fedora/RHEL/CentOS.
